Well normally I can get muta's in time. But tbh I don't know the best timing as you have to start lair at about 7 minutes to get the mutalisks out in time. Not sure of any other ways as infestors never works for me, roach/hydra can as long as you can avoid an engagement in a choke. It's a stupid push . Another thing I know that works vs that immortal all in is baneling drops :D.

I've felt the best way to hold immortal sentry was ling/roach, and when he pushes out with just immortal/sentry before any warp-ins, you kill off some of the sentries or at least the energy. You just get 200/200 vs his push, and eventually you win, but I think burrow move is really the best against it (usually though it comes too late, but the idea is to hold with just mass roach/ling at first, and then burrow move really seal the deal if he's really attcking hard).

http://www.gomtv.net/2012gsls2/vod/67148
avenge vs sniper being the best example of the this (avenge all-in immortal/sentry, kills the third, sniper gets burrow move eventually and destroys avenge's army easily when he tries to finish the game, and then he goes on to win later on after retaking his third).

ive never really seen hydras work, but i've heard some people say they are the answer (maybe it was you lol).

You were so gas starved because you made so many roaches and kept trying to put on pressure/kill him. Yes getting banelings after making a ton of roaches and keep making roaches is going to leave you more gas starved then normal. Also going mutalisks vs phoenix was a bad idea xD, when I see phoenix (4+) I will make some corruptors and no mutalisks and go straight into infestors.

Your infestors were super late as well, almost 16 minutes into the game and 0 infestors. This is very odd to me as you aren't even slowly making infestors it seems you just try to mass them all at once xD.

When you get infestors that late you will never be able to afford that because you are spending so much gas to get them all at once more so then slowly. By this I mean, I start off getting 6 infestors and it builds as the game goes on. You have to spend all your gas on them whenever you want them because you dont' build on it, you have 2 by 17 minutes into the game which you should have way more of by then. By 18 you have 9 which is good, but could have had it sooner if you had started infestor production way sooner.

Also that toss should not have let that neural work lol. That game in general was kind of a bad one to try to show why you prefer infestors over both. He also let you get 6 bases almost uncontested, idk that game was just kinda bad to showcase why you disagree. If you are going to go heavy roach/ling aggression and not get infestors until 17 minutes into the game then yes getting banelings will be insanely hard, if not impossible if you want brood support ^^.

ultra hydra baneling is a good combo. You need something to deal with forcefield I think. Flanks help yeah but good forcefields can still beat rolling banelings. I also like getting baneling drops while teching broodlord since it allows me to be aggressive with that army. I don't think simply getting banelings in themselves is that good unless you are countering mothership.
